The short version

Turbotville has roughly average household income, with a median household income of $40,221. Population has held roughly steady since 1990. Median home value has risen by half since 1990, reaching $86,700. Poverty is rare here, at 3.8% of residents.

Frequently asked

How many people live in Turbotville, Pennsylvania?

Turbotville, Pennsylvania has about 691 residents according to the 2000 Census.

What is the median household income in Turbotville, Pennsylvania?

The typical household in Turbotville, Pennsylvania earns about $40,221 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.

Is Turbotville, Pennsylvania expensive?

In Turbotville, Pennsylvania, the median home is worth about $86,700, and the typical rent is about $413 a month.

How educated are people in Turbotville, Pennsylvania?

About 17.7% of adults age 25 and over in Turbotville, Pennsylvania h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in Turbotville, Pennsylvania?

About 3.8% of people in Turbotville, Pennsylvania live below the federal poverty line.

Has Turbotville, Pennsylvania grown since 1990?

Yes, Turbotville, Pennsylvania has grown since 1990. The population has added about 27 residents, a change of about 4 percent over that period.
